Does Hawaii have any indigenous snakes?
Hawaii has no native snakes, and it’s illegal to own the animals in the islands.
Why are there no native snakes in Hawaii?
Being so isolated, the plants and animals that have reached and evolved on the islands had to travel more than 2,000 miles from the nearest continent or had to ride the winds from other far flung Pacific islands. Given this isolation, you can see why there are no native snakes in Hawaii.
What is the only snake in Hawaii?
yellow-bellied sea snake
The only snake to reach Hawaii by its own means is the yellow-bellied sea snake which lives mostly in the waters around Hawaii.
Where in the world are there no snakes?
States/areas with no snakes:
- Siberia (Northern Russia)
- Alaska.
- Greenland.
- Antarctica.
- Central and Northern Canada.
- The southern tip of Argentina and Chile.
- The northern part of Finland, and anywhere north of the Arctic Circle.

Where do snakes live in Georgia?
Snakes can be found in most backyards, parks, and woodlands throughout Georgia. Many species are secretive, spending most of their time underground or under cover. Active gardeners may occasionally see small ringneck, worm, red-bellied, brown, earth, and crowned snakes.
